Tragedy Strikes: Arturo Gatti’s Son Found Dead Mysteriously in Mexico

Tragedy has struck the boxing world once again with the mysterious death of Arturo Gatti’s son in Mexico City. The young boxer, just 17 years old, was found dead on Monday in his home. Multiple sources have confirmed the heartbreaking news.

Mysterious Circumstances Surrounding His Death

Arturo Gatti Jr. was discovered by a neighbor, though the exact cause of his death remains unclear. At the time of the incident, his mother, Amanda Rodrigues Gatti, was in Mexico with him. Since the passing of her husband in 2009, Amanda has traveled frequently with her son, often sharing heartfelt messages dedicated to him on social media.

Training and Aspirations

At the time of his death, Gatti’s longtime trainer, Mo Latif, was on his way to Mexico. Latif aimed to bring the promising boxer back to Montreal for training. Arturo Gatti Jr. began boxing at the age of six, training at Ring 83 gym just a few kilometers from their family home.

  • Debuted in boxing at age 6.
  • Was preparing for a professional fight in Mexico on June 14, but was removed from the card for unknown reasons.
  • Fought an amateur match in October 2023.

Over the past few years, Gatti Jr. had the opportunity to meet several friends of his father’s, including boxing legends like Mike Tyson and Leonard Dorin. These encounters contributed positively to his young career as he aimed to carve out his path in the sport.

Similarities to His Father’s Death

The untimely passing of Arturo Gatti Jr. echoes the tragedy of his father’s death in 2009. Arturo Gatti Sr. was found in his apartment in Pernambuco, Brazil. Initially ruled a suicide, the inquiry led to the arrest of his wife, Amanda, who was later cleared of charges after an autopsy and investigation.

Aspirations in Boxing

In a 2019 interview, Arturo Gatti Jr. expressed his ambition to follow in his father’s footsteps. He spoke about his desire to become a boxing champion, highlighting similarities in their fighting styles. “I want to have a career like my father,” he stated. “I share his warrior spirit.”
